Here is how I do my nails. I actually paint them every Monday, and usually touch up for the weekends as needed. When I get out of the shower I remove my old nail polish. I do not dry my hair first, I put my make up on. Before I start my makeup I paint my nails. I usually only use one heavy coat and that is it. About half way through my makeup I put on the top coat. By the time I am done with my makeup my nails are dry. I very rarely have any smudges while I do this.
